Why Specialty Lab Testing Matters

Many health issues begin at the cellular level, often before noticeable symptoms appear. Specialty lab tests can:

  • Identify nutrient deficiencies impacting energy, immunity, and brain function
  • Assess genetic predispositions for diseases like diabetes, heart disease, and osteoporosis
  • Detect hidden inflammation and oxidative stress contributing to chronic conditions
  • Analyze hormonal imbalances affecting metabolism, mood, and aging
  • Uncover environmental toxin exposure and food sensitivities

These advanced diagnostics empower individuals and healthcare providers to develop targeted prevention plans, fine-tune treatment approaches, and optimize long-term health.

1. Cellular & Micronutrient Testing for Nutritional Optimization

Your body needs the right balance of v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ants to function optimally. These tests assess nutrient absorption at the cellular level to detect hidden deficiencies.

Key Tests for Nutritional Health:

  • Cellular Micronutrient Assay – Measures intracellular levels of vitamins, minerals, amino acids, and antioxidants.
  • Antioxidant Protection Assay – Evaluates oxidative stress and free radical damage, helping prevent premature aging and disease.

Best for: Individuals with fatigue, brain fog, weak immunity, or those looking to optimize nutrient intake.

3. Inflammation & Cardiac Risk Assessment

Chronic inflammation is a silent driver of many diseases, including heart disease, autoimmune disorders, and metabolic conditions. These tests measure inflammatory markers and cardiovascular health risks.

Key Inflammation & Heart Health Tests:

  • C-Reactive Protein Quantitative (qCR) – General inflammation marker linked to autoimmune and chronic disease.
  • C-Reactive Protein (CRP, High Sensitivity, Cardiac CRP – Preferred) – A more sensitive test for detecting cardiovascular inflammation and heart disease risk.

Best for: Individuals with high blood pressure, heart disease risk, chronic pain, or autoimmune conditions.

4. Cancer & Bone Health Screening

Certain cancers and bone diseases can develop without noticeable symptoms. These tests assess key biomarkers for early detection and prevention.

Key Cancer & Bone Health Tests:

  • CA125 Cancer Antigen (CA) 125 Serum – Screens for ovarian cancer risk and tumor activity.
  • Bone-Specific Alkaline Phosphatase (Osteoporosis Panel) – Measures bone turnover markers to assess osteoporosis risk.
  • Osteoporosis Risk Panel Comprehensive – Evaluates bone density and mineral metabolism.

Best for: Postmenopausal women, individuals with a family history of cancer or osteoporosis, and those at risk for bone loss.
